A networking equipment company that has repositioned its Silicon One chip portfolio, advanced networking, and optical products as critical infrastructure for AI data centers. Cisco reported record fiscal Q3 2026 revenue of $15.84 billion (up 12% year-over-year) with networking revenue up 25% to $8.82 billion, and sharply raised its full-year AI infrastructure order outlook to $9 billion after hyperscalers ordered $2.1 billion in Q3 alone.

Reportedly in advanced talks to acquire Axonius for $2B; company denied it

24% confidence

Cisco was reported in January 2026 to be in advanced talks to acquire Israeli cybersecurity firm Axonius for roughly $2 billion, but Axonius publicly denied the report, stating it was 'not in talks to be acquired by Cisco' and emphasizing its strategy to remain independent.

Based on unnamed-source reporting that the target company itself has explicitly denied; included as an example of a reported deal that did not proceed to confirmation.

Reportedly in talks to acquire AI security startup Astrix for $250-350M

42% confidence

Cisco was reported to be in talks to acquire cybersecurity startup Astrix Security for between $250 million and $350 million, with people familiar with the matter saying conversations were underway before any final agreement; the deal was later confirmed and completed on June 29, 2026.

The specific price range was reported by The Information citing people familiar with the matter ahead of Cisco's own confirmation of the deal terms.

  2. May 2026 · Record Q3 FY2026 revenue, raises AI order outlook to $9B

    Cisco reported record fiscal Q3 2026 revenue of $15.84 billion (up 12% year-over-year) and net income of $3.37 billion, with networking revenue up 25% to $8.82 billion beating consensus; the company sharply raised its full-year 2026 AI infrastructure order outlook to $9 billion after hyperscalers ordered $2.1 billion in Q3 alone via its Silicon One portfolio, advanced networking and optical products, sending shares up 17%.
